陆源有机污染对舟山海域大型底栖生物分布的影响

摘    要:2009年4月对舟山海域进行了25个站位的底栖生物调查,结合同期进行初级生产力、海水水质等的调查数据,分析了初级生产力、富营养化等环境因子对舟山海域大型底栖生物分布的影响。结果表明,舟山海域大型底栖生物共获得84种,多毛类是主要优势类群。舟山海域大型底栖生物平均生物量为11.62g/m2,平均丰度为208.5个/平方米,多样性指数(H')为1.64。舟山海域大型底栖生物的生物量、丰度和多样性指数均呈现由近岸向外海递增的趋势。应用相关性统计分析表明,舟山海域大型底栖生物的分布与海水化学耗氧量(COD)、无机氮(DIN)、磷酸盐(DIP)、富营养化指数和底层溶解氧(DO)存在显著负相关;与初级生产力、盐度和透明度存在显著正相关。说明陆源有机污染、盐度、透明度、初级生产力和底层溶解氧是影响舟山海域大型底栖生物分布的主要因素,其中陆源有机污染是最主要的影响因素。

Effects of Terrigenous Organic Pollution on Distribution of Macrobenthos in Zhoushan Sea

Abstract:25 stations were established to investigate the macrobenthos in Zhoushan sea in April 2009. Compared with the investigate data of primary productivity, seawater quality etc., the effects of environmental factors on distribution of macrobenthos in Zhoushan sea were analysed. The results showed that 84 species were identified, and Polychaeta was the dominant group. The total average biomass was 11.62g/m2, the total average abundance was 208.5ind. /m2, and the Shannon-weaver index (H') was 1.64. The distributions of abundance, biomass and Shannon-weaver index (H') were all high in offshore area, and low in nearshore area. Using correlation analysis, the distribution of macrobenthos showed significant negative correlations with COD, DIN, DIP, eutrophication index and bottom water DO; and significant positive correlations with Chl a, salinity, transparency. It was concluded that terrigenous organic pollution, primary productivity, salinity, transparency, bottom water DO were the main factors determining distribution of macrobenthos in Zhoushan sea, and terrigenous organic pollution was the most important factor.
